Industry Growth and Technological Advancements
According to industry reports, global online gambling revenue reached an estimated $66.7 billion in 2022, representing a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 11% since 2019. This growth is largely attributable to technological advances such as mobile platforms, live dealer games, and artificial intelligence (AI)-driven personalization strategies.
Mobile devices now constitute over 70% of all online gambling activity, underscoring the importance of mobile-optimized casino environments. Leading operators leverage these trends by adopting seamless, cross-platform experiences that cater to both novice players and seasoned high rollers.
Data-Driven Innovation in Player Engagement
One of the key differentiators in contemporary online casinos is the integration of sophisticated data analytics to optimize player retention and lifetime value. Industry leaders utilize real-time behavioral data to curate personalized game recommendations, tailored promotions, and responsible gambling safeguards.
For example, predictive analytics models have demonstrated the ability to increase user engagement by up to 25% where implemented effectively, transforming passive gameplay into an interactive, adaptive experience. These innovations are underpinned by sensitive data collection and transparent privacy policies, fostering trust and compliance within the industry framework.
Regulatory Complexity and Market Dynamics
While technological advances open new avenues, they also introduce regulatory complexities. Jurisdictions vary considerably in their approach to licensing, anti-money laundering (AML) standards, and player protection measures. Industry leaders must navigate this patchwork responsibly, often leveraging reputable compliance tools and platforms to demonstrate transparency.
